The shrinkray CLI handles batch image resizing for customer asset pipelines. Support staff should know the basics: jobs are defined in a manifest file, run with `shrinkray run`, and output lands in the customer's staging bucket. Failed batches can be resumed with the --continue flag; never delete the checkpoint directory mid-run. Logs live under the jobs folder and rotate daily. To access the support sandbox where test batches run, unlock the shared credential store using the recovery passphrase below.

vault phrase of bagaf-kajeg = jorath-feniel-briir-siliel-ralix

TURN-208: Gatevale turnstile counters at the Merrow Field pilot double-count when a rotation reverses mid-cycle. Attendance totals drift roughly 2% high per event. The debounce window fix is implemented, reviewed by Ilsa, and soak-tested across two simulated match days without drift. Ready for your cut; the candidate build is identified below.

trace token, tagag-tafog: htk6_5ed18c

Catalog entries in Lanternfish are cached per-region. Writes from the Merchant Console publish an invalidation event; edge nodes drop the stale entry and lazy-reload on next read. Do not add manual cache flushes — they mask event-bus failures. If an item looks stale, check the invalidation consumer lag first. Bulk imports bypass events and trigger a full segment sweep instead, which is why imports are throttled. TTLs exist only as a safety net, never as the primary mechanism. Current tuning constants are as follows.

tuning constants:
QUOTAS = {
    "druwyn": 5,
    "holix": 5,
    "zorath": 5,
    "holwyn": 10,
}

// Fixture: monthly partitions for orders_ledger (Venborough schema).
// Generates three partitions: prior month, current, next. Boundary rows
// land on the first of each month at 00:00 UTC — off-by-one here has
// bitten us twice. Do not hardcode dates; the helper derives them from
// the frozen test clock. Partition names follow p_YYYYMM. If you add
// a fourth partition, update the pruning assertion too. The fixture
// seeds via the Hollis ingest API and authenticates with the token below.

portal login ticket: eyJhbGciOiJIUzI1NiIsInR5cCI6IkpXVCJ9.eyJzdWIiOiIwEOsktwVNwIn0.-UJU3fdyyCgG